public string DeleteSucursal(int Id) { string _request = ""; try { ContextMarvelVirtual _context = new ContextMarvelVirtual(); var result = _context.Sucursales.SingleOrDefault(x => x.Activo == true && x.IdSucursal == Id); if (result != null) { result.Activo = false; _context.SaveChanges(); _request = "1"; } } catch { _request = "0"; } return(_request); }
public string UpdateSucursal(int Id, string Nombre, string Ubicacion, string Telefonos) { string _request = ""; try { ContextMarvelVirtual _context = new ContextMarvelVirtual(); var result = _context.Sucursales.SingleOrDefault(x => x.Activo == true && x.IdSucursal == Id); if (result != null) { result.Nombre = Nombre; result.Ubicacion = Ubicacion; result.Telefonos = Telefonos; _context.SaveChanges(); _request = "1"; } } catch { _request = "0"; } return(_request); }
public string AddSucursal(string Nombre, string Ubicacion, string Telefonos) { string _request = ""; try { ContextMarvelVirtual _context = new ContextMarvelVirtual(); int _Id = _context.Sucursales.Max(x => x.IdSucursal) + 1; var _User = _context.Usuarios.FirstOrDefault(); var _sucursalAdd = new Sucursales { IdSucursal = _Id, Nombre = Nombre, Ubicacion = Ubicacion, Telefonos = Telefonos, IdUsuarioAlta = _User.IdUsuario, FCreacion = DateTime.Now, Activo = true }; _context.Sucursales.Add(_sucursalAdd); _context.SaveChanges(); _request = "1"; } catch { _request = "0"; } return(_request); }